Mumbai, September 17, 2025 – With the festival of Navaratri just around the corner, Sony Entertainment Television is preparing to launch a new mythological series, Chalo Bulawa Aaya Hai, bringing viewers a fresh dose of faith and celebration.
The nine-day festival that honors the many forms of Maa Durga begins next week, and the channel’s latest offering aligns perfectly with the spirit of devotion. Centered on the divine story of Maa Vaishno Devi, the show promises to deepen the festive mood for audiences across the country.
“Navaratri is a time when the entire nation turns to worship and reflection. This show is designed to add another layer of reverence,” said a Sony spokesperson. The network expects the series to resonate with viewers in the same way that Mahavatar Narsimha did during Krishna Janmashtami.
Actor Avinesh Rekhi, who plays the role of Sagar Singh Lodhi, described the part as both inspiring and rewarding.
“Sagar is a courageous soldier devoted to his country and family. After portraying many intense roles, this character allows me to explore themes of faith and devotion. It’s also my first time playing a Subhedar, which is exciting for me and my audience,” he shared.
Produced by One Life Studios and created by Siddharth Kumar Tewary, Chalo Bulawa Aaya Hai follows the journey of a young girl named Maniki, portrayed by Payoja Shrivastava, whose unwavering faith in Maa Durga becomes the heart of the narrative. The cast also includes Aleya Ghosh, Puneet Vashisht, and others.
Chalo Bulawa Aaya Hai premieres 22 September and will air every evening at 8:30 p.m. on Sony Entertainment Television and stream simultaneously on Sony LIV.
